The Oregon neighborhood of Rockwood is a dynamic and diverse area that bridges Portland with the city of Gresham; Rockwood lies east of downtown Portland and comprises the westernmost neighborhood of the city of Gresham. At the heart of the neighborhood runs East Burnside Street, weaving through the center of Rockwood and following the MAX light rail tracks as they span east to west.
The affordable neighborhood appeals to families on a budget and people looking for access to both Portland and Gresham. Rockwood contains several parks and green spaces for recreation and exercise.
